About The Bark Park
Located right in the heart of Folly Beach, The Bark Park offers a sandy escape for your pup, though it may leave some owners yearning for a bit more. The park is small and tightly fenced, making it easy to keep an eye on your dog. With limited parking available, a visit can feel like a tight squeeze, especially during peak times when the local dog crowd shows up. Be prepared for some sand in your car, as the surface can get messy after a day of play.
Dog owners appreciate the clean water available for their furry friends and the picnic tables scattered throughout for a bit of relaxation. While many enjoy the social aspect of being amongst other dog enthusiasts, some find the atmosphere cliquey, with existing regulars seemingly more focused on chatting than supervising their dogs. This can lead to chaotic encounters, especially if your dog is shy or not interested in exuberant play.
The park is a short walk from the beach, making it a convenient pit stop for a sandy adventure. However, the terrain and the presence of nearby towers raise some health and safety concerns, particularly regarding ticks. If you’re considering a trip, a bath afterward may be in order, especially for pups used to grassy play. Overall, The Bark Park has its charms but comes with a few quirks that may not suit every dog owner’s preference.
